  • the present invention relates to a watch and in particular a small wristwatch comprising a movement made up of a set of components mounted on a plate and covered with a protective cap.
  • the cap has a peripheral rim and shoulders serving as support for the plate driven out inside the rim.
  • the cap it is preferable to mount the cap on the plate by different means, this in order to reduce the external dimensions of the cap.
  • the watch according to the invention is carac ⁇ terized in that it comprises means associated with the battery fixing flange, for fixing the cap on the plate.
  • these means comprise a pillar secured to the plate, a screw which passes through the free end of the flange and the head of which bears on it to fix it on said pillar, and a metal ring concentric with said screws and whose lower and upper edges are respectively in contact with the printed circuit and the battery fixing flange.
  • This ring has a peripheral groove, in which the conical flange provided around an opening of the cap is driven, concentric with said ring.
  • FIG. 1 represents a top view of the block fixed by the retaining screw of the flange which maintains the stack
  • Figure 2 shows an enlarged sectional view of the fixing means of the cap.
  • the cap 101 shown seen from above in FIG. 1 has a slightly oblong opening 102 which allows the easy replacement of the electric battery 103.
  • This battery is held in position by a flange 104 whose free end has an opening for the passage of a fixing screw 105.
  • the other end is curved in the shape of an S and engages in a recess (not shown) arranged in the thickness of the side wall of the cap.
  • the cap also comprises a central opening 106 which allows access to the frequency corrector (not shown) and two openings for the passage of the screws 107 and 108 intended to make the watch face integral and platinum.
  • Guide flanges 109, 110 and 111 facilitate the positioning of the cap on the plate.
  • the means for fixing the cap 101 on the plate 112 essentially comprise a pillar 113 whose end 114 of reduced diameter is chased in a bore 115 of the plate, a ring 116 and the screw 105.
  • the pliers 113 includes a shoulder 117 on which the substrate 11 of the printed circuit rests, and a second shoulder 119 intended to center the substrate 118.
  • the upper annular face of the ring 116 is in contact with the flange 104 on which the flat head of the screw 105 rests engaged with a tapping 120 arranged in the pillar 113.
  • the cap 101 has a circular opening concentric with the ring 116 and whose edge 121 has a conical shape which cooperates with a peripheral groove 122 of the ring 116 for retaining the cap 101 in position.
  • the ring 116 has a double function. On the one hand, it is in contact with the metallized track 123 of the printed circuit carried by the substrate 118, which makes it possible to ensure passage ; of the current from this metallized track to the flange 104 and, consequently, to the battery 103. On the other hand, it ensures, thanks to its peripheral groove 122, the maintenance of the monkfish 101 on the plate 112.

Abstract

Watch and more particularly wrist-watch of small size. This watch comprises a dome (101) which is fixed onto the plate (112) by means of a metal ring (116) concentric with the screw (105) which allows to secure the holding strap (104) of the electrical battery (103) on the post (113) driven on the plate (112). This securing system provides for a good stability of the dome and is particularly appropriate to small sizes.
